Quicksy Bridge vs Synapse
A side-by-side comparison of two self-hosted apps from related categories — licensing, setup difficulty, resource needs, and what each one replaces.
Not the right match-up?
Quicksy Bridge
XMPP gateway providing phone-number based messaging
VS
Synapse
Reference homeserver for the Matrix network
| Feature | Quicksy Bridge | Synapse |
|---|---|---|
| Category | Chat & Communication | Matrix & XMPP |
| License | GPL-3.0 | AGPL-3.0 |
| Language | Java | Python |
| Setup difficulty | Hard | Hard |
| Min. RAM | 512 MB | 1,024 MB |
| Deployment | docker, bare-metal | docker, bare-metal |
| GitHub stars | ★ 3,000 | ★ 4,503 |
| First released | 2018 | 2014 |
| Replaces | WhatsApp, Signal | Slack, Discord, WhatsApp |
